Diecasting has emerged as one of the most pivotal processes in Malaysia’s manufacturing trade, taking part in a crucial position in the manufacturing of advanced and excessive-quality metallic components. This manufacturing method includes forcing molten metallic, sometimes aluminum or zinc, into a mildew at high pressure, which allows for the creation of precisely formed parts which are important for industries equivalent to automotive, electronics, and shopper goods. The rapid rise in demand for such components, each domestically and internationally, has pushed Malaysia’s diecasting sector to develop significantly in latest years.
